Round 4 - InfRC - (generated with code version - commit db388ad3)
- Reference measurement - Steve's access of 100 byte objects on single server - 7000 ns
- Single server round trip time - 100,000 measurements - 100 byte objects in 4833 ns run-bench script
- No load - 100,000 measurements - master/co-ord on rc01, client on rc02 - 100 byte objects in 5109 ns run-perf script
- No load - 10,000,000 measurements - master/co-ord on rc01, client on rc02 - 1000 byte objects in 5093 ns run-perf script
- 10.0.0.x NICs were used.
- 1 hour passes - cluster is as idle as the last experiment. But.....
- Single server round trip time - 100,000 measurements - 100 byte objects in 9869 ns run-bench script
- No load - 100,000 measurements - master/co-ord on rc01, client on rc02 - 100 byte objects in 9878 ns run-perf script
